Machining: Precision That Drives Modern Manufacturing
Machining is an industrial process in which material is removed from raw stock to create highly precise components. Using advanced CNC equipment (lathes, milling machines, EDM systems and more), Admati achieves tolerances down to thousandths of a millimeter. The company works with a wide range of materials, from aluminum, steel and stainless steel to titanium, copper and engineering plastics.

Sheet-Metal Bending: From Flat Sheet to 3D Component
Sheet-metal bending is an industrial process that transforms flat metal sheets into precisely shaped components with complex angles and forms. Using advanced CNC machinery, Admati works with a variety of metals — black steel, galvanized steel, stainless steel, aluminum — achieving high precision and full consistency across production batches.

This capability serves diverse industries, among them electronics, enclosure manufacturing, automotive, aerospace and medical equipment. Admati provides a complete end-to-end solution, encompassing laser cutting, punching, bending and finishing, all under one roof with unified quality control.

Dual Quality Control: From Factory to Customer
Maintaining precision, consistency and uniformity throughout the production process is a central challenge in mechanical manufacturing. "It's not just about producing an initial sample that meets specifications, it's ensuring that the same quality is maintained in full-scale production, without deviations between batches," notes Shkolnik.

For this, the company operates a dual quality-control framework: inspections conducted by the manufacturing facility itself and independent quality-control processes managed by third-party inspection firms engaged by Admati. Full-scale production is not authorized until final sample approval.

International Quality and Reliability Standards

  • ISO 9001 – An internationally recognized EU quality standard management that defines structured work processes, control mechanisms and continuous improvement.
  • ISO 13485 – A specialized quality standard for the medical and medical-device industries.
  • AS9100 – A quality standard for aerospace, defense and mission-critical sectors.
  • IATF 16949 – A global quality management standard for the automotive and transportation industries.
  • Additional ISO standards – Applied as required, depending on the project and on customer needs.
